spidermike007 Posted October 23, 2015 Share Posted October 23, 2015 (edited) The head is just a tad bit stronger than an eggshell. The skull remaining intact, and unbroken, is quite essential for healthy living. It is not about our skills. It is about the morons. It is about the kids who lack driving skills and judgment. It is about living out your remaining years to their utmost potential. I have a friend who was driving her bike a month ago, on Samui. She was driving slowly. But, it was raining, and the visibility was limited. Someone plowed into her, head on, on another bike. Both of them are still in the hospital a month later. She broke her leg, and her arm. But, worst of all she was not wearing a helmet, and went down quite hard, on her head. They operated on her brain. She still is incapable of speech, and the entire right side of her body is paralyzed. We all hope this is temporary. But, there is a good chance a good helmet would have saved her. Anyone who rides without a helmet is taking a helluva lot for granted, and is tempting fate, to say the least. nikster Posted October 24, 2015 Share Posted October 24, 2015 "I might be paranoid, but I feel like it would be my fault if anything happen to him" Utter nonsense. It wouldn't be your fault, nor should you feel like it would be. If he can be convinced by statistics, there are numerous ones that show how dangerous Thailand's roads are. The death rate is staggering - IMO much of that has to do with not wearing helmets, and driving drunk. I've seen a kid lying in a pool of blood on the road after falling over on his bike - I am not sure he was actually dead but if not then very close to it. the same accident with helmet would be a couple of scratches and no hard feelings. If you happen to come off the bike at normal speeds, which can happen, and bump your head on the road then a helmet makes the difference between death and walking away. So that's my reasoning. impulse Posted October 24, 2015 Share Posted October 24, 2015 Riding a 2 wheeler is 2000%-4000% more dangerous than riding in a 4 wheel vehicle. (US and Oz studies) Wearing a helmet reduces the chance of being killed by 40%. (Same studies) He crossed the safety Rubicon when he got on a 2 wheeler. Kerryd Posted November 5, 2015 Share Posted November 5, 2015 I just had a wipe out on my Harley 2 days ago when I got cut off by a motorcycle vendor that suddenly decided to veer in front of me. After I stopped tumbling down the road I stood up and made my way to the far left side. Took off my helmet (skid lid) and made a phone call. Bought a coke from the shop I was at and then I noticed my helmet. Had a rather large, nasty gouge where it seems my head had either slide along a concrete barrier on the side of the road, or from the road itself. Had I not been wearing the helmet I would have lost a chunk of my skull (larger than a 10 baht coin at least) and instead of needing a new skid lid I'd probably be in the hospital having brain surgery done and hoping I don't get infected.
